Find Out What Your Old Laptops Are Worth

In what ways can organizations precisely assess the worth of their outdated laptops? When evaluating the worth of older devices, organizations should examine several critical considerations. First, the age and condition of the laptops play a vital role; laptops that are newer and well-maintained tend to sell for greater amounts. Specifications, such as processor speed, RAM, and storage capacity, also greatly influence value.

Moreover, the demand in the market for specific makes and models can fluctuate, influencing the potential for resale. Organizations should examine current market trends and evaluate similar listings on resale platforms to gauge competitive pricing.

Organizations must also examine any pre-installed software and warranties that may enhance the device's value. Finally, businesses might utilize certified appraisal services to ensure a more thorough evaluation. Through the careful analysis of these factors, businesses can reliably assess the value of their outdated laptops, guaranteeing the highest possible return on investment throughout the asset recovery process.

Compliance and Data Security

At a time when data breaches are becoming more frequent, prioritizing compliance and data security is critical for any asset recovery partner. Companies need to select partners that follow relevant regulations, such as GDPR and HIPAA, to safeguard sensitive information during the recovery process. A trustworthy partner should have comprehensive data destruction protocols, ensuring that all data is irretrievably wiped from devices before being disposed of or resold. Additionally, certifications such as NAID AAA and R2 indicate a commitment to high standards in data security and environmental responsibility. By choosing an asset recovery partner that prioritizes compliance and data security, businesses can mitigate risks, protect their reputations, and increase the value recovered from their retired laptop assets.

Implement Data Security Measures Before Disposal

Before disposing of laptops, putting robust data security measures in place is vital to secure sensitive data. Organizations must prioritize the secure deletion of data stored on devices to prevent unauthorized access post-disposal. This entails employing dedicated software that complies with industry benchmarks for data wiping, making certain that all stored data is completely and irreversibly removed.

Moreover, the physical destruction of hard drives may be necessary for critically sensitive information. learn the details Processes such as degaussing or shredding make the data completely unreadable, providing an extra layer of security. It is also essential to retain detailed documentation of the disposal process, capturing the methods applied and the personnel responsible.

Instructing employees on the importance of data security during asset recovery can greatly improve safeguards against potential breaches. By implementing robust security protocols, organizations can minimize risks associated with data exposure, thereby preserving their reputation and compliance with industry regulations.

How to Assess Your Laptop Recovery ROI

How can businesses accurately evaluate the return on investment (ROI) from laptop asset recovery initiatives? To accurately measure ROI, businesses should first assess the complete costs involved in the retrieval operation, including logistics, refurbishing, and data wiping. Next, they must assess the monetary gains derived from remarketing or recycling the reclaimed devices. This involves measuring earnings from resale opportunities and savings achieved through minimized disposal fees.

In addition, companies can assess qualitative benefits, such as strengthened organizational standing through sustainable practices and heightened employee satisfaction from ethical asset oversight. Evaluating these aspects yields a thorough view of the program's effectiveness.

Finally, establishing critical performance metrics can help organizations monitor progress over time, guaranteeing that the laptop asset recovery process continues to support core business goals. By systematically evaluating quantitative and qualitative factors alike, businesses become equipped to make well-informed choices with respect to their asset management strategies.

Which Certifications Should My Asset Recovery Partner Possess?

A reputable asset recovery partner must have certifications like R2, e-Stewards, and ISO 14001. Such credentials confirm conformity with environmental standards, data security requirements, and sustainable recycling practices, thus improving confidence and dependability in their offerings.
